IAND-Baustein
Kurz-Information
Name | IAND |
---|---|
→POE-Typ | →Funktion |
Kategorie | IEC-Baustein, BitstringEnh |
Konform zur →IEC-Norm | nicht in IEC-Norm vorgesehen |
Grafische Schnittstelle | |
Verfügbar ab | Version 1.23.0 (für logi.CAD 3) |
Funktionalität
Der Baustein liefert das Ergebnis einer bitweisen UND-Verknüpfung aller an den Eingängen anliegenden Werte von ANY_INT
.
Vergleiche: "AND-Baustein" für UND-Verknüpfung der Werte von ANY_BIT
.
Eingänge, Ergebniswert
Bezeichner | →Datentyp | Beschreibung | |
---|---|---|---|
Eingänge: | IN1 | , , , , , , oder
(entspricht dem →allgemeinen Datentyp ANY_INT )
| 1. Wert |
IN2 | , , , , , , oder
(entspricht dem →allgemeinen Datentyp ANY_INT )
| 2. Wert | |
... (ausziehbar bis) | |||
IN16 | , , , , , , oder
(entspricht dem →allgemeinen Datentyp ANY_INT )
| 16. Wert | |
Ergebniswert: | – | , , , , , , oder
(entspricht dem →allgemeinen Datentyp ANY_INT )
|
Der Eingang EN
und der Ausgang ENO
sind für den →Aufruf des Bausteins verfügbar. Siehe "Ausführungssteuerung: EN, ENO" für Informationen zum Eingang EN
und zum Ausgang ENO
.
Informieren Sie sich unter:
- "Bausteine für sichere Logik", ob dieser Baustein für das Entwickeln von sicherheitsrelevanten Anwendungen unterstützt wird.
- "Kennzeichnung von sicherer Logik im FBS-Editor", welche Auswirkung die Verwendung des Bausteins als Baustein für sichere Logik hat.
Beispiel für Verwendung im ST-Editor
PROGRAM Test VAR result1, result2, result3, result4 : INT; END_VAR result1 := IAND(IN1 := 2, IN2 := 2); (* The variable 'result1' evaluates to '2'. *) result2 := IAND(IN1 := 2, IN2 := 5); (* The variable 'result2' evaluates to '0'. *) result3 := IAND(IN1 := 3, IN2 := 9); (* The variable 'result3' evaluates to '1'. *) result4 := IAND(IN1 := 5, IN2 := 5); (* The variable 'result4' evaluates to '5'. *) END_PROGRAM
Bei der Erstellung Ihrer Anwendung im ST-Editor erstellen Sie den Aufruf eines Bausteins, indem Sie den laut Syntax erforderlichen Text eintippen oder die Inhaltshilfe verwenden.